la � <br /> File No. 20-3551-01 II n KLEIN FELDER <br /> January 27, 1992 S <br /> bbb <br /> M C-5: <br /> "other -.p�reformation as required by the San Joaquin Local Health <br /> District1to determine the cumulative effect of the existing and the <br /> propose developmentilon groundwater contamination;" <br /> li II <br /> Our scope of services did not include a detailed evaluation <br /> of the potential for the septic systems to affect the <br /> quality of groundwater. However, the project involves only <br /> r a maximum of sixteen systems on an approximate 150-acre <br /> property. Therefore, with groundwater at least 140 to 145 <br /> feet deep, the hikelihood of a significant change in the <br /> nitrate level of'ithe groundwater beneath the site is very <br /> remote. If additional more concentrated development is <br /> planned in the area, we suggest that consideration be given <br /> to completing anitrate loading study. <br /> This completes our scope of work at this time. Based on the above <br /> information, it is or opinion that the subdivision is suitable for <br /> septic system use. The septic systems should be located and future <br /> wells should be constructed following County requirements <br /> Continuous monitoring of the septic systems should be maintains <br /> throughout the duration of their use.
